seventy-five grubby "S.W." attired in pyjamas all fighting for baths!! There is a big Turkish bath place in the grounds, 4 in at a time to be scrubbed & douched! Oh the joy of that bath - public or no public! The bath "scrum" went on for hours - in fact till the water ran out.
After a late breakfast, a number of the British inhabitants came out for us & took us in to town & showed us some of the "sights" - we went along the Nicholas Boulevard, a lovely terrace over-looking the Harbour.
It was a brilliant day & the view from the picturesque Boulevard of the busy, wide-reaching Docks & the deep-blue sea beyond, fringed on it's [its] W. & S.W. horizon by the grey & pink highlands of the Khersonesc & Crimean shores, is was a perfectly enchanting one. Odessa strikes one as such a gay, happy town; crowded out of door cafés, big, beautiful hotels, bands playing here & there, & throngs of light-hearted, well-dressed promenaders strolling along the shady length of the Boulevard or sitting about in the pretty gardens, that
